Reshape of lat and lon coordinates in MongoDB, using the aggregate pipeline

Reshape of lat and lon coordinates in MongoDB, using the aggregate pipeline Summary To transform a large number of documents in a MongoDB collection with spatial data, for example: {lat: -58.1, lon: -34.2} to a GeoJson format, recognizable by MongoDB spatial analysis functions, for example: {type: ”Point”, location: [- 58.1, -34.2]} It seems advisable to use the aggregation framework: db.tweets.aggregate ([{$project: {location: {type: "Point", coordinates: ["$lon", "$lat"]}}}, $ out: {$out: "newcollectionname"}] );   The problem An usual task in the database in MongoDB may be to prepare the data for spatial tasks. As I described in the previous post, it is necessary to have the data in the compatible format, in this case as a GeoJson. For example, if we are working with points: {type: ”Point”, location: [- 58.1, -34.2]} {type: ”Point”, location: [- 58.1, -34.2]} That is, specifying a "type" key that specifies that it is a point, and then a "location" key with an array of the coordinates pair: longitude and latitude (in that order!)
